TECHNICAL DATA GAIN CONTROLLED MICROPHONE FIER/VOGAD PREAMPLI- The KK6270 is a silicon integrated circuit combining the functions of audio amplifier and voice operated gain adjusting device (VOGAD). It is designed to accept signals from a low sensitivity microphone and to provide an essentially constant output signal for a 50dB range of input. The dynamic range, attack and decay times are controlled by external components.
